Additive and multiplicative Sidon sets

We give a construction of set $$A \subset \mathbb N$$ such that any subset $${A' A}$$ with $$|A'| \gg |A|^{2/3}$$ is neither an additive nor multiplicative Sidon set. In doing so, we refute conjecture Klurman and Pohoata.

On Multiplicative Sidon Sets
Fix integers b > a ≥ 1 with g := gcd(a, b). A set S ⊆ N is {a, b}-multiplicative if ax 6= by for all x, y ∈ S. For all n, we determine an {a, b}-multiplicative set with maximum cardinality in [n], and conclude that the maximum density of an {a, b}-multiplicative set is b b+g . متن کاملGeneralized Sidon sets
We give asymptotic sharp estimates for the cardinality of a set of residue classes with the property that the representation function is bounded by a prescribed number. We then use this to obtain an analogous result for sets of integers, answering an old question of Simon Sidon. © 2010 Elsevier Inc. All rights reserved. MSC: 11B
